What are part time weekend jobs?

Part time weekend jobs are positions that require employees to work primarily on Saturdays and Sundays, often with flexible or reduced hours compared to full-time roles. These jobs can be found in a variety of industries, such as retail, hospitality, healthcare, and customer service. They are ideal for students, individuals seeking supplemental income, or those who need a work schedule that allows for weekday commitments. Part time weekend jobs typically offer hourly pay and may not always include benefits, but they provide valuable work experience and flexibility.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ive in a part-time weekend job, and why are they important?

To thrive in a part-time weekend job, you generally need reliability, time management, and relevant experience or qualifications depending on the specific industry (such as retail, hospitality, or healthcare). Familiarity with point-of-sale systems, scheduling applications, or other job-specific tools may be required. Strong communication, flexibility, and a positive attitude help you adapt to changing demands and interact effectively with customers or colleagues. These skills are important because weekend roles often require independent work, quick learning, and providing consistent service during peak business hours.

What are some common challenges faced in a part-time weekend position, and how can I prepare for them?

Part-time weekend roles often require flexibility and the ability to handle busy periods, as weekends typically see higher customer traffic or demand. You may also encounter challenges balancing this job with other commitments, such as studies or a full-time role. Effective time management and clear communication with your employer about your availability can help. Additionally, weekend teams are sometimes smaller, so being adaptable and ready to take on varied tasks is valuable. Building strong teamwork skills will enable you to collaborate efficiently with colleagues and provide consistent service.

What is the difference between Part Time Weekends vs Part Time Evenings?

AspectPart Time WeekendsPart Time Evenings
Work SchedulePrimarily weekends, typically Saturday and SundayPrimarily evenings during weekdays, e.g., 5 PM - 9 PM
Work EnvironmentRetail, hospitality, customer service settingsRetail, food service, customer support roles
Required CredentialsBasic skills, sometimes customer service experienceSimilar credentials, often same roles
Employer UsageBusinesses needing weekend coverageBusinesses needing evening shifts during weekdays

Part Time Weekends and Part Time Evenings both offer flexible schedules for part-time roles, but differ mainly in their work days. Weekends focus on Saturday and Sunday shifts, ideal for those with weekday commitments, while evenings cover weekday hours, suitable for students or those with daytime obligations. Both options are common in retail, hospitality, and customer service industries.

SHIFT: Every weekend, shifts alternate each week:

Week 1: Saturday 8am-1:30pm, Sunday 8am-1:00pm

Week 2: Saturday 1:30pm-7pm, Sunday 1pm-5pm

Your Responsibilities:

  • Welcomes all persons who enter the Community in a courteous manner; informs, guides, directs or otherwise assists residents, visitors, staff or vendors tactfully and congenially to present the best possible image of the Community.
  • Opens and closes the reception desk and properly secures all files, keys and equipment in the office area.
  • Communicates to the appropriate parties, promptly and clearly, all messages and material directed to them through the business office.
  • Accepts and records, as directed, payments, reservations, appointments, cancellations and the like.

What Success Looks Like:

  • High School graduate preferred.  Ability to communicate efficiently in English using proper grammar in a pleasant manner.
  • Typing and experience with other business machines very desirable.
  • Must be able to handle a multiplicity of routine tasks, following specific instructions carefully and general instructions completely.
  • Enjoy presence of elderly people and have a friendly and caring attitude.
  • Able to maintain records and flexible schedule with little supervision.
  • Live our Extraordinary Impressions Values.
